Advanced process management infrastructure
A critical component of our process management infrastructure is
an application referred to internally as Sequence. Sequence uses
advanced data management techniques to isolate and analyse hundreds
of errors and issues with the delivered data.
Some of the more common issues identified by Sequence
include:
- More than one vendor name exists for the same vendor key
- Vendor records exist with no vendor name
- Transactions exist with no related vendor records
- The same postcode is repeated in ten or more vendor
addresses
- Incidences of duplicate net spend rows exist in
transactions
- Included out of scope spend
- More than 12 months of spending were found in transactions
- High probability of payments to individuals
